However, modern amphibious assaults are not conducted like D-Day. The key positions on the beach are seized by Special Forces shortly before the main body arrives by sea. The Special Forces arrive by swimming ashore as frogmen, parachuting small teams from high altitude, by helicopter or by Osprey.
There is an example of this approach being used in combat. In the 1982 Falklands war landings at San Carlos the Argentines had a reinforced infantry platoon stationed on a high feature and in the village. A platoon of the Special Boat Service (roughly the Royal Navy equivalent to US Navy Seals) was landed by helicopter 5 km from the Argentine positions. With naval gunfire support they forced the Argentines off the high feature. The Argentines then conducted a fighting withdrawal while being pursued by the SBS platoon. The main body arrived by boat less than 30 minutes later.
If the landings are conducted by the USMC the main body would arrive on a mixture of LCACs, AVCs and LAV-25s. The LCAC is a hovercraft that is invulnerable to small arms fire, typically travels at 40 knots (46 mph or 74 km/h) and can go past the waterline of the beach before unloading a light marine company in an area with cover from fire. LCACs are typically offloaded from their mother ships at 29-58 miles (46-93 km). However, they can be offloaded at ranges over 115 miles (185 km) from the landing beach.
The USMC also has two armored vehicles (the ACV and LAV-25) that can swim at 7-9 Mph (10-14km/h) while carrying a rifle squad. These vehicles are invulnerable to anything up to 25mm cannons and light anti-tank weapons. They can be launched into the water up to 14 miles (22 km) from their mother ship.
This means at night, or during white haze days (about 60% of this time of year) the USMC can offload LCACs, ACVs and LAV-25s at beyond visual range of the islands and bring troops ashore to a beach that has hopefully already been at least partially secured by Navy Seals and MARSOF. If not, the troops coming ashore have armored protection against at least small arms fire.
If Iran switches on their marine radars they would be able to target the LCACs and the Amphibious support ships. However, it’s unlikely Iran would manage to sink these vessels. The LCACs would be well within the air defence missile range of the Arleigh Burke destroyers escorting the amphibious ships. The Amphibious ships are well equipped with CIWS systems. Shahed drones are also not very effective against warships in comparison to ASMs, so Iran’s munitions options would be more limited than against merchant vessels and static targets.
There would be a risk, and with the number of troops on board these ships one hit would mean dozens or hundreds killed. It would also require expending huge amounts of precious interceptor missile stockpiles. But in terms of military operations in the Straits of Hormuz the USN is fairly well prepared and equipped to protect the amphibious landing force.
The much bigger threat is to American troops ashore after an island is seized. The large majority of Iran’s plentiful Shahed drones have guidance systems for striking fixed, rather than moving, targets. At the short flight times involved this means anything that stays in one location for more than 10-15 minutes could have a Shahed landing on top of it.
Iran can also use fiberoptic guided FPV drones against some of the islands. During the Ukraine war initially cheap civilian drones had an RPG or grenade strapped to them to use as a makeshift hybrid of artillery and a guided missile. Their range was limited to a few kilometres and they were susceptible to jamming. This led to their carrying spools of fiberoptic cables, as they are immune to jamming and can increase the range, typically to 20-30 km.2 Many of the complications with these fiberoptic drones (like the cable being snagged or cut) would not apply in the Straits of Hormuz, where most of the flight path would be over water.
Finally, Iran has conventional artillery and MLRS that have the range to hit some of these islands. The table below shows the main indirect fire weapons Iran has with a range above 18km.
Of these weapons the long range artillery is fairly small in number, so it would be more of a harassing weapon. The two weapons systems with the range and numbers to cause serious problems are the BM-11 MLRS at 52 km and the M1954 Artillery at below 27 km.
Seizing Hengam and Larak would significantly undermine Iran’s observation and firepower at the narrowest part of the Straits of Hormuz. This would require approximately a marine regiment (the same size as an army brigade) to conduct.
Seizing the lane islands is, if anything, more important due their sitting in the middle of the navigable lane through the straits. It’s not necessary to seize Farur to open up an unobserved shipping lane, so it can be left alone at least at first. Seizing the remaining three islands would also require a marine regiment, though these landings could be done in sequence using some of the same troops as for Larak and Hengam.
The four lane islands held by Iran effectively expand the choke point of the Strait of Hormuz an additional 150 km. Since Iran holds them, merchant ships sailing through the strait under darkness or on white haze days will be under Iranian visual observation until they pass Siri or Farur, rather than after they pass Hengam. The table below shows the key military information about these islands.
This map shows how seizing these 4 islands would impact Iran’s visual range on white haze days.
Farur should be bypassed, at least initially. It’s the least important for reducing Iranian visual coverage of the strait. It is also within range of MLRS, long range artillery and some fiberoptic FPV drones. It would require more troops to seize, as it is about twice the size of the other three islands, and does not appear to have much military presence.
Tunb probably cannot be bypassed. It’s too prominently astride the shipping lane and there are Iranian ASM missile launchers based on the island. It is within MLRS and long range artillery range of Qeshm island, but not the mainland. This makes it viable to prevent shelling of Tunb with sufficient counter-battery fire.
Abumusa and Siri both should be seized. They are well fortified, but also outside of MLRS, artillery and fiberoptic drone range. US troops on those islands would ‘only’ be subject to strikes from long range strike weapons like Shahed drones.
Qeshm is a large island right at the choke point of the Strait of Hormuz. As has been noted several times, Qeshm is about the size of Okinawa. There are two smaller islands that protrude more into the strait, Hengam and Larak.
Invading Qeshm should be ruled out for the near to medium future. It is a division plus sized objective (4-5 manoeuvre brigades). The US currently has 1-2 manoeuvre brigades in the area, and bringing this up to 4-5 would take at least a month or two. Qeshm also has a population of 150,000, including a 38 sq km city of Qeshm. For comparison, Stalingrad was about 250 sq km in 1942 and Avdiivka was about 29 sq km. So while it’s not Stalingrad, it’s a large enough urban area to cause significant problems if the Iranians make a stand there. Qeshm is also under the range of even medium artillery from the mainland.
The US does have the units in the region to seize Hengam and Larak. Hengam is within range of all of Iran’s indirect fire assets from Qeshm, which can be managed with a good counter-battery fire plan. Larak, however, is both heavily fortified and within range of Iran’s MLRS and long range artillery from the mainland. This makes Larak a difficult objective to take and hold.
To give a sense of Larak’s location, here is an image of Larak taken from the beach on the city of Qeshm, a city the US does not have the resources in theatre to seize anytime soon.
Larak, however, probably needs to be seized to open up the Straits of Hormuz. It overlooks the narrowest part of the strait. It is dominated by 120m high hills that give excellent visibility into the strait.
Nearly the entire island is a military base, with entrenchments and ASM run up positions. Given Iran’s use of underground facilities there’s likely a lot below ground that I can’t see on satellite imagery.
We have also seen that Iran is using passing between Qeshm and Larak as a type of toll booth, so that only ships they approve of can transit the Straits of Hormuz.
Frankly, to open up the Straits of Hormuz Larak probably needs to be taken. However, taking it would leave the occupying garrison exposed to a large volume of Iranian retaliatory firepower.
War sucks and sometimes there isn’t a low risk solution.
Assuming Siri, Abumusa, Tunb, Hengam and Larak are seized Iran’s visual detection range for white haze days would be significantly degraded, as shown in the map below (with the dashed line showing Iran’s range after those islands were seized).
If America controls these islands they could also base air defence systems there. The map below shows the range of stinger missiles and the Ukrainian drone interceptors from the islands. As you can see, it creates an overlapping wall of drone interceptors that Iranian Shahed’s need to cross to reach the shipping lane.
Therefore we have a series of risky island invasions. The landings themselves probably would not result in high casualties, but Iranian bombardment of the garrisons would be a serious problem. This is particularly the case for Larak, but it is also the island that most needs to be seized.

Kharg is economically important, and therefore would be a good bargaining chip for negotiations. Though there’s a certain oddity to seizing Kharg to control Iranian oil exports when the US is giving Iran a special exemption to oil sanctions and doing nothing to stop Iranian tankers exiting the Straits of Hormuz.
Kharg itself is about the size of Hengam and half the size of Larak. However, it is about 80% built up area, making this nearly a brigade sized objective. It is also well fortified and within range of the mainland for everything except medium range artillery.
I don’t think it’s wise to take Kharg island by airborne or helicopter assault. There doesn’t appear to be any viable drop zones on the island. There are only two good company sized helicopter landing zones on the island: the airport in the north, and a sports field in the south. Those two potential HLZs will probably be covered with mines and machine guns. There are three other mediocre to poor company HLZs on the island, but Kharg has so much built up area that small special forces teams are probably the ceiling on air insertion without exposing the troops to significant risk.
This means Kharg would need to be assaulted from the sea, unless someone is willing to sign off on a tremendous level of risk. This risk could be accepted and it might work. But it’s almost as likely to end with a failed assault and hundreds of casualties.
For Kharg to be assaulted by the sea the US Amphibious ships need to come through the Straits of Hormuz. LCACs could be offloaded around Qatar, but they don’t have the operational range to be launched outside the strait. To launch LSVs the US amphibious vessels need to come within about 25 km of Kharg island. This would make them vulnerable to attacks from the mainland, but the alternative is for the landing force to consist of mostly light troops without support from armoured vehicles.
War sucks and sometimes there isn’t a low risk solution.
Ospreys can be launched outside the straits, but that means committing to an air assault. Ospreys also cannot carry heavy equipment or vehicles, so eventually ships would need to be brought through the strait to give the MEU the heavy equipment it needed to withstand holding Kharg island.
Therefore I would leave any assault on Kharg island to after the seizing of Larak, Hengam and the lane islands. An amphibious task force could then transit the Straits of Hormuz to support a combined assault from the air and sea. This would have the additional benefit of lessening Iran’s ability to exert pressure on global oil markets. It would also make supporting the garrison on Kharg much easier, both logistically and through supporting them with the navy’s own air defence systems.
America can improve its position in the war by seizing a number of islands in the Persian Gulf. The risks vary from low to very significant, as it means putting ground troops within much closer range of Iranian retaliator firepower.
USMC operations to seize islands in the Persian Gulf would not look like Saving Private Ryan, since amphibious landings haven’t been done that way since the Korean War. Key features would be first seized by special forces, with the main body being brought ashore by a collection of boats and amphibious AFVs that can resist at least small arms fire.
The larger risk of Iranian retaliation would come after the beach landings, with Iran using drones, MLRS, fiberoptic FPV drones and in some cases even artillery to pound the American garrison.
By seizing Siri, Tunb and Abumusa the narrow choke point length of transiting the strait would be reduced by about 150 km. Seizing Hengam and Larak would significantly degrade Iran’s observation and firepower at the narrowest point of the strait.
However, these two islands would come under significant fire from mainland Iran and Qeshm. The US does not have enough troops in the region to seize Qeshm, and even if they did they would then come under the same unacceptable level of fire from mainland Iran.
Seizing Kharg is best either ignored or left as a follow on operation, after the five islands near the Strait of Hormuz have been seized. All these options would improve the US position in the Straits of Hormuz and for the war in general. They would also allow give Iran a lot more options for killing American service personnel.

As an aside Omaha beach wasn’t like Saving Private Ryan. Although certain companies took up to 96% casualties, the 1st wave suffered about 40% casualties throughout the entirety of D-Day. The first two Regiments ashore (making up the first three waves) suffered 33% casualties on D-Day and 33% casualties on the first two days respectively. The Omaha beach landing as a whole involved 43,250 troops, with about 3,600 casualties (8%), of which 770 were killed (1.7%)
This is horrific, as in most tactical actions you expect below 5% casualties, but it’s not what Saving Private Ryan showed. Famously it has 109 on screen deaths in an opening scene that featured the first two landing waves. Using the ratio of dead to wounded Saving Private Ryan implies there were at least 605 casualties from the first hour. In fact, the Ranger Company and nearby units suffered about 400 casualties in the course of the entire day.
Also, there’s way too many MG-42, the bunkers are far too complex, the ratio of killed to wounded is too high, etc.
